In more recent years he has focused on breaking the stereotypes that have long defined him, daring to different things, from projects to his outfits for high-impact events, interviews and special articles in famous magazines. During his meeting with FT He talked about the image of a strong man that he had to sell to the media, a type of masculinity that does not allow feeling or showing.
It’s exhausting to be anything but who you are. You have to understand, at least where I grew up, we’re more of a Clint Eastwood character: you have it all, you’re capable, you can deal with anything, you show no weakness. I see that in my father and in previous generations of actors and, man, it’s exhausting. As I get older, I find much comfort in friendships where you can be [completamente tú mismo], and I want that to spread to the outside world. What people think of this: I’m fine. I feel safe here because there is a focus on our struggles as human beings, because it is full of danger. And joy too.
